BTW....I didn't start off with Marans eggs. I breed Marans roos to hens I thought would produce pink. I have pink EE hens too, so between those I worked at getting a dark pink without it looking brown. Add the blue and you get lavender.

I think I know who that is. I have been talking to her about buying some eggs. Have you seen the pictures yet? It seems as though her purple shade is coming from the bloom, not the actual shell. Purple bloom is not that uncommon, but her chickens seem to lay with it regularly. I haven't decided on if I should get some of hers or not, please let me know how your experiance goes?
